What are the instructions for submitting this form?
Submit this completed form to the Chancery Court of your county in Mississippi. You can either file it in person or, where applicable, use online submission methods through the court's official website. Ensure that any required fees are paid and that all necessary signatures are obtained before submission.

What is the purpose of this form?
The purpose of this form is to provide a standardized process for couples seeking divorce in Mississippi. It allows both parties to declare their terms amicably and file them with the court. The joint complaint aims to streamline the divorce process by specifying custody, support, and property settlements.

Tell me about this form and its components and fields line-by-line.

- 1. Jurisdiction: Details about the court's jurisdiction over the parties.
- 2. Marriage Details: Information about the date and place of marriage.
- 3. Separation Date: Date when the parties separated.
- 4. Children Information: Names and birthdates of any minor children.
- 5. Property and Debt: Agreement terms related to marital property and debts.
